The graph analytics market is experiencing significant growth and is poised for further expansion in the coming years. Graph analytics refers to the analysis of interconnected data points or entities, represented as nodes and edges in a graph structure. This methodology enables businesses to uncover valuable insights, patterns, and relationships that are otherwise difficult to identify through traditional data analysis techniques.

Graph analytics involves the use of advanced algorithms to examine complex relationships between various entities, such as customers, products, social media connections, and more. By leveraging graph analytics, organizations can gain a deeper understanding of their data, enabling them to make informed decisions, optimize operations, enhance customer experiences, detect fraud, and improve overall business performance.

Key Market Insights

  1. Growing Demand for Relationship Analysis: Businesses across industries are recognizing the importance of understanding relationships between data points. Graph analytics provides a powerful tool for analyzing and visualizing these relationships, allowing organizations to extract valuable insights from their data.
  2. Rise in Fraud Detection and Prevention: Graph analytics is increasingly being utilized in fraud detection and prevention efforts. By analyzing complex networks of transactions, relationships, and behaviors, organizations can identify suspicious patterns and mitigate potential fraud risks more effectively.
  3. Adoption of Graph Analytics in Social Media Analysis: With the proliferation of social media platforms, companies are leveraging graph analytics to analyze social networks, identify influencers, understand customer sentiment, and enhance their marketing strategies.
  4. Integration of Graph Analytics with Machine Learning and AI: The integration of graph analytics with machine learning and artificial intelligence technologies is enabling organizations to leverage the power of interconnected data for more accurate predictions, personalized recommendations, and advanced decision-making.
  5. Increasing Adoption across Multiple Industries: Graph analytics is finding applications in various sectors, including finance, healthcare, retail, transportation, and telecommunications. Each industry has unique use cases for graph analytics, such as customer segmentation, supply chain optimization, patient network analysis, and more.

Market Opportunities

Thegraph analytics market presents several opportunities for growth and development:

  1. Emerging Applications in IoT: The Internet of Things (IoT) generates vast amounts of interconnected data. Graph analytics can play a crucial role in analyzing and extracting insights from IoT data, enabling organizations to optimize operations, improve efficiency, and enhance the overall IoT ecosystem.
  2. Adoption in Healthcare and Life Sciences: The healthcare and life sciences sectors can leverage graph analytics to analyze patient data, identify disease patterns, improve clinical outcomes, and accelerate medical research and drug discovery processes.
  3. Expansion in E-commerce and Personalized Recommendations: Graph analytics can enhance personalized recommendation engines in e-commerce platforms. By analyzing customer behavior, preferences, and purchase history, organizations can offer more relevant product recommendations, improving customer satisfaction and driving sales.
  4. Integration with Cybersecurity: Graph analytics can bolster cybersecurity efforts by detecting and mitigating complex cyber threats. By analyzing network traffic, user behavior, and relationships between entities, organizations can identify anomalies, detect potential breaches, and strengthen their overall security posture.
  5. Application in Supply Chain Optimization: Graph analytics can optimize supply chain management by analyzing the relationships between suppliers, products, and logistics networks. This enables organizations to identify bottlenecks, streamline operations, and improve overall supply chain efficiency.

What is graph analytics?

Graph analytics refers to the process of analyzing data that is represented in graph structures, focusing on the relationships and connections between data points. It is widely used in social network analysis, fraud detection, and recommendation systems.
